TRANSPORTATION ENGINEER (CIVIL)

Caltrans is the California Department of Transportation, dedicated to providing a safe and reliable transportation network. The Transportation Engineer (Civil) will perform a variety of professional engineering tasks on highway construction projects, ensuring compliance with contract documents and may act as an Assistant Structure Representative or Resident Engineer.

Responsibilities

Perform a wide variety of professional engineering work in either an office or field setting
Work as a field engineer to ensure contractors build structures in compliance with the contract documents
Act as an Assistant Structure Representative or Assistant Resident Engineer/Resident Engineer on construction projects

Required

Possession of a valid Driver's License is required when operating a state or personal vehicle on official business in performance of their duties driving to various field locations as required
Appointment to Range D requires a valid Professional Engineering License (Civil) issued by the California Board of Registration for Professional Engineers. For all other ranges, a PE license is not required
Possession of Minimum Qualifications will be verified prior to interview and/or appointment
If you are basing your eligibility on education, you must include your unofficial transcript(s)/diploma for verification
Unofficial, original, or official sealed transcripts will be accepted and may be required upon appointment
Applicants with foreign transcripts/degrees must provide a transcript/degree U.S. equivalency report evaluation that indicates the number of units and degree to which the foreign coursework is equivalent
